Asite is seeking an E-learning Designer to join our Learning team in London. In this full-time role, you will create interactive training resources for users in the construction industry. Your expertise will be essential in developing innovative e-learning materials using tools like Articulate Storyline and Adobe Creative Suite.

The position requires collaboration with trainers and customers to ensure engaging learning experiences. If you are passionate about digitalisation in construction, we want to hear from you!

How to prepare for a job interview at Asite

Know Your Tools Inside Out

Make sure you’re well-versed in Articulate Storyline and Adobe Creative Suite. Familiarise yourself with their latest features and think of examples where you've used them to create engaging e-learning materials. This will show your technical prowess and passion for the role.

Showcase Your Collaboration Skills

Since the role involves working closely with trainers and customers, be prepared to discuss past experiences where you successfully collaborated on projects. Highlight how you gathered feedback and adapted your designs to meet user needs, demonstrating your ability to create engaging learning experiences.

Understand the Construction Industry

Brush up on the current trends and challenges in the construction industry, especially regarding digitalisation. Being able to speak knowledgeably about how e-learning can address these issues will set you apart and show your genuine interest in the field.

Prepare Engaging Questions

Think of insightful questions to ask during the interview that reflect your enthusiasm for the role and the company. For instance, inquire about the types of projects the Learning team is currently working on or how they measure the effectiveness of their training resources.
